Friendly, melodic names shine for female pups. Favourites like Luna, Bella, Daisy, Lucy, Lily, and Rosie are popular for a reason - clear, upbeat, and trainer-approved. Consider Hazel, Ivy, Ruby, Piper, Winnie, and Nova if you want timeless with a twist.

Short, bold, and easy to call—male dog names often carry a strong consonant that pops at the park. If you like classic choices, start with Charlie, Max, Cooper, Milo, Leo, and Duke; for modern vibes, try Finn, Theo, Hudson, or Maverick.

Want something fresh that still passes the “trainer test”? Unique picks like Cosmo, Orion, Echo, Zephyr, Indie, or Rogue stand out without confusing your dog during cues.

Cute names lean short and sweet, perfect for cuddle bugs and clowns. Think Waffles, Mochi, Peanut, Biscuit, Poppy, and Teddy - each one fun to say and great for positive recall.

For confident, athletic dogs, strong names offer presence and clarity. Try Rex, Thor, Atlas, Diesel, Titan, or Xena - each delivers punchy syllables and crisp consonants for clear recall.

Outdoorsy families love names that nod to trails, lakes, and sky. Willow, River, Aspen, Juniper, Skye, and Clover are calm, earthy picks that age beautifully.
